I'm gonna just jump in a little bit on page five. I think you are further instructed. Well, let me go through these definitions a little bit above this. Reasonable belief means a belief that would be held by an ordinary and prudent person in the same circumstances. As the defendant. So that's the reasonable person standard that we were talking about. And it's based on, like, that person, not necessarily you as an individual. Deadly force. (1:06:29–1:06:38)
